Abahani Limited Dhaka and Bashundhara Kings got

off a winning start in the BFF U-18 Football League that has begun from today

(Saturday) at three separate venues in the city.

At Bashundhara Kings Arena practice ground, Abahani Limited blanked Fortis

Football Club by 2-0 goals in the inaugural match of the opening day with

Dipu and Yeasin scored one goal each for the winners in the 11th and 63rd

minutes respectively.

Vice-President of Bangladesh Football Federation (BFF) and Professional

League Management Committee’s Chairman Md. Imrul Hasan, its general secretary

Imran Hossain Tushar and member Mohidur Rahman Miraj were present in the

opening ceremony.

At armed-police battalion field at Uttara, Bashundhara Kings defeated

Rahmatganj Muslim and Friends Society by 2-1 goals.

In the proceeding, Shofiq and Asad scored one goal each for Kings in the

45+3rd and 52nd minutes respectively while Delowar pulled one back for old

Dhaka outfit Rahjmatganj in the 90+3rd minute of the match.

At Mohammadpur’s
government physical education training ground, Sheikh Jamal

Dhanmondi Club split point with Bangladesh Police Football Club when their

match ended in a 1-1 goal draw.

In the day’s match, Zuhan put Police FC ahead in the 17th minute while Hridoy

scored the equalizer for Sheikh Jamal in the 78th minute of the match.
